Applications of Metal Forging Across Machinery, Tools, and Structural Components

The Metal Forging significantly enhances wear resistance, making it suitable for components subjected to high friction and repetitive loads. Forged gears, shafts, and industrial rollers demonstrate increased longevity compared to cast or machined alternatives. Metal Forging strengthens the grain structure, providing durability under heavy mechanical stress.

Components produced via forging maintain performance over extended service periods, reducing maintenance requirements and operational downtime. Metal Forging is particularly valuable in mining, automotive, and heavy machinery industries where wear and fatigue are critical considerations.

The long-term reliability and enhanced wear resistance of Metal Forging make it a preferred choice for manufacturing high-performance, durable components. Its ability to withstand extreme conditions ensures efficiency and safety in industrial operations.
